In summary, the main things the scheme I describe gives us are:
- control over startup/shutdown order with the numbers
- accomodates older scripts (by just not having the K script
linked to the S, script things wont be started again at
shutdown time).
- enough similarity to SYSV to not confuse
- ability to easily disable scripts (rename to not start with S[0-9]
or K[0-9])
